Four-star 2022 guard Bryce Griggs signs with Overtime Elite


, the No. 44 overall prospect in the 2022 class, has decided to forgo his college eligibility and join Overtime Elite, sources told 247Sports. The 6-foot-2, 180-pound combo guard out of Missouri City (Texas) is the second prospect this week to make the move to turn pro early. The Texas prospect has become known as one of the best scorers in the 2022 class. (247 Sports)
